How to Skip Stones

It can be very satisfying to fling a stone into the water and watch it gracefully skip over the wet surface. Getting the technique down for skipping stones can take a little practice. Here are some tips on how to skip stones.

Difficulty: Moderately Challenging
Instructions
  1. Step 1

    Select your stones.

    Choose stones that are smooth, flat, and of uniform thickness. It should fit comfortably into your hand and be light enough to easily throw.

  2. Step 2

    Place the stone in your hand.

    Hold the stone in your hand using your thumb and middle fingers. Curl your other fingers under the stone without holding it too tightly.

  3. Step 3

    Throw the stone.

    Face the water at a very slight angle. Lift your arm up and use a snapping motion to rapidly extend your arm towards water. Release the stone when your arm is fully extended. The stone should be thrown outward at a slight downward angle to allow the stone to slide across the surface of the water. For best results release the stone quickly with a wrist snap.

Tips & Warnings
  • The best time to skip stones is when the water is calm and placid. You'll have little success if the water is choppy.
